What Are AI Agents?

An AI agent is an intelligent software system that can perceive information, reason about it, take actions, and continuously improve based on outcomes.

Unlike traditional automation tools that follow fixed rules, AI agents can:

  • Understand natural language
  • Analyze business data
  • Make contextual decisions
  • Execute multi-step workflows
  • Learn from interactions
  • Integrate with enterprise applications

They function as digital teammates capable of handling repetitive, data-driven tasks across departments.

How AI Agents Differ from Traditional Chatbots

While chatbots primarily answer predefined questions, AI agents are designed to complete actions.

A chatbot may:

  • Answer FAQs
  • Provide product information
  • Direct users to resources

An AI agent can:

  • Qualify leads
  • Schedule meetings
  • Update CRM records
  • Generate proposals
  • Process customer requests
  • Trigger workflows
  • Escalate complex issues automatically

This ability to perform tasks—not just conversations—makes AI agents significantly more valuable for businesses.

AI Agents for Sales Automation

Sales teams spend a large portion of their time on repetitive administrative work instead of building customer relationships.

AI sales automation helps eliminate these inefficiencies.

Lead Qualification

AI agents can:

  • Analyze inbound inquiries
  • Score leads based on predefined criteria
  • Identify high-intent prospects
  • Route qualified leads to the right sales representative

This ensures sales teams focus on opportunities most likely to convert.

Personalized Outreach

AI agents generate personalized:

  • Cold emails
  • Follow-up messages
  • Meeting invitations
  • Proposal summaries

Using CRM data and customer behavior, they tailor communication to improve engagement.

CRM Automation

Instead of manually updating records, AI agents automatically:

  • Log customer interactions
  • Update deal stages
  • Record meeting notes
  • Create follow-up tasks
  • Generate pipeline reports

This improves data accuracy and saves valuable time.

Sales Forecasting

By analyzing historical sales data and pipeline activity, AI agents provide insights into:

  • Revenue projections
  • Deal health
  • Sales performance
  • Risk identification

These insights help leadership make informed decisions.

AI Agents for Customer Support

Customer expectations continue to rise, with users expecting instant, accurate, and personalized assistance.

AI agents enable support teams to meet these expectations while reducing operational costs.

24/7 Customer Assistance

AI agents provide around-the-clock support by:

  • Answering customer questions
  • Resolving common issues
  • Guiding users through troubleshooting
  • Escalating complex cases when needed

Intelligent Ticket Management

AI agents automatically:

  • Categorize support tickets
  • Prioritize urgent requests
  • Assign tickets to the appropriate teams
  • Track resolution progress

This streamlines support operations and reduces response times.

Knowledge Base Assistance

AI agents retrieve information from company documentation to deliver accurate, context-aware responses without requiring customers to search manually.

Multilingual Support

Businesses serving global markets can use AI agents to provide support in multiple languages, improving customer experience across regions.

Best Practices for Implementing AI Agents

Successful AI adoption requires careful planning.

Recommended practices include:

  • Identify repetitive, high-volume tasks.
  • Define measurable business objectives.
  • Integrate AI agents with existing systems.
  • Ensure data security and compliance.
  • Monitor performance continuously.
  • Keep humans involved in decision-making where necessary.
  • Train employees to collaborate with AI tools.

A phased implementation approach often delivers the best results.
